Indigenous Community Business Fund

Indigenous Community Business Fund

Communities and collectives of First Nations, Inuit, and Métis can apply for financing to support their community-owned companies whose earnings have been impacted by COVID-19. The Indigenous Community Business Fund contributes $117 million in non-repayable financial contributions to support community– or collectively-owned companies and microbusinesses whose revenues have been impacted by the COVID-19 pandemic.
